If the water is down (between October 15 and May 15, generally, there are multiple fishing docks at Chester Frost Park). Lake Chickamauga is formed from the Chickamauga Dam and provides hydro electric power and aids in flood control. Therefore the water is lowered by TVA during the off season months, generally beginning in October and ending in May. During these months, the dock's water level is generally too low for your boat. However Chester Frost Park (2 miles away) provides free access to a boat ramp, multiple docks, and several fishing docks. Also enjoy the fire pit located beside the pavilion.
